Todd William Knutsen holds a FINRA CRD (Financial Industry Regulatory Authority Central Registration Depository) license, which is required for individuals engaged in securities sales and investment advisory work. This registration means he is subject to FINRA's regulatory oversight and must comply with industry standards for conduct and competence. The CRD license signals that he has met baseline qualifications and undergoes ongoing compliance monitoring, providing a layer of regulatory accountability in his financial advisory practice.
